WHAT YOU WILL LEARN
ACTION SHOOTING
Saturday Dry-Fire Training: 7:30pm - 9:00pm
This is a crucial training session where students will learn the fundamentals of marksmanship and firearms safety. We will then go handgun and rifle grip, sight picture, trigger pull, drawing from a holster, speed reloading firearms, and safely moving between shooting positions all while using unloaded firearms and training pistols. This session will be held at Bay Jiu-Jitsu.
Sunday Rifle Live-Fire Session: 10:00am - 12:00pm
Students will review the principles of marksmanship and firearms safety. After that we will go over the basic principles and techniques of "Action Shooting," a category of shooting sports that involves elements like shooting multiple targets quickly and moving while shooting. This session will be entirely done with a semi-automatic rifle chambered in 22lr.
Sunday Pistol Live-Fire Session: 1:30pm - 4:00pm
Students will review the principles of marksmanship and firearms safety with a semi-automatic handgun. After that we will go over our action shooting skill set again, but with the appropriate modifications required for the difficult to master skill of centerfire pistol shooting.
Sunday '2 Gun' Live-Fire Session: 4:30pm - 6:30pm
In our final shooting session, students will get to test their skills in a timed action stage that requires use of both the rifle and the handgun with multiple reloads, moving targets, and fast footwork.

NO GI GRAPPLING
Saturday Grappling Session 1: 10am - 12pm
Students will learn how to apply trips, sweeps, and throws common in SAMBO in a no gi grappling environment.
Saturday Grappling Session 2: 1:30pm - 3:30pm
This session will focus on attacking the guard with a combination of passing and submission threats in no gi.
Saturday Grappling Session 3: 4:00pm - 6:00pm
The final grappling lesson will focus on aggressively attacking from bottom position while finding opportunities to work back to your feet.
